Fatale fout: toegestane geheugengrootte van 268435456 bytes uitgeput (geprobeerd om 71 bytes toe te wijzen)

Ik krijg een foutmelding wanneer ik een van mijn dashboardpagina’s in mijn wordpress-script probeer te openen

De foutmelding is als volgt:

Fatale fout: toegestane geheugengrootte van 268435456 bytes uitgeput (geprobeerd
om 71 bytes toe te wijzen) in
/home/admin/domains/filesick.com/public_html/wp-includes/taxonomy.php
online 2685

Ik vroeg wat rond en kreeg te horen dat ik de geheugenlimiet moest verhogen tot iets hoger dan 256M, dus ik veranderde het in 512M en nog steeds hetzelfde probleem. Toen veranderde ik het in 3024M en dit is wat ik nu heb, maar dat loste het probleem niet op.

Kun je me alsjeblieft vertellen hoe ik dit kan oplossen en wat ik moet doen?

Wachten op uw reactie.


Antwoord 1, autoriteit 100%

WordPress heft PHP’s geheugenlimiet op tot 256M, in de veronderstelling dat wat het eerder was ingesteld, te laag zal zijn om het dashboard weer te geven. U kunt dit overschrijven door WP_MAX_MEMORY_LIMITte definiëren in wp-config.php:

define( 'WP_MAX_MEMORY_LIMIT' , '512M' );

Ik ben het eens met DanFromGermany, 256M is echt veel geheugen voor het renderen van een dashboardpagina. Het veranderen van de geheugenlimiet is echt een verband om het probleem.


Antwoord 2, autoriteit 30%

Ik had dit probleem. Ik heb op internet gezocht, alle adviezen opgevolgd, configuraties gewijzigd, maar het probleem is er nog steeds. Uiteindelijk ontdekte hij met de hulp van de serverbeheerder dat het probleem ligt in de definitie van de MySQL-databasekolom. een van de kolommen in de a-tabel is toegewezen aan ‘Longtext’, wat leidt tot 4.294.967.295 bits geheugen. Het lijkt goed te werken als u de MySqli-verklaring voor voorbereiden niet gebruikt, maar zodra u de instructie voorbereiding gebruikt, probeert het die hoeveelheid geheugen toe te wijzen. Ik heb het kolomtype gewijzigd in Mediumtext waarvoor 16.777.215 bits aan geheugenruimte nodig zijn. Het probleem is weg. Ik hoop dat dit helpt.


Antwoord 3, autoriteit 9%

Ik heb de geheugenlimiet gewijzigd van .htaccess en dit probleem is opgelost.

Ik probeerde mijn website te scannen met een van de antivirus-plug-ins en daar kreeg ik dit probleem. Ik heb het geheugen vergroot door dit in mijn .htaccess-bestand in de WordPress-map te plakken:

php_value memory_limit 512M

Nadat het scannen was afgelopen, heb ik deze regel verwijderd om het formaat te maken zoals het ervoor was.

Other episodes